Decision guide

Start with local fit before visibility

Whitehorse consumers should compare whether an agent actively works in the relevant neighbourhoods, property types, and price bands before giving weight to review volume, digital reach, or broad profile visibility.

Use profile depth carefully

Average profile signal depth is 1.3 per profile. That is useful for discovery, but consumers should still verify live licensing, brokerage relationship, current reviews, and representation terms.

Match the agent model to the client need

3 team profiles appear in this market. Consumers should ask who handles pricing, showings, offers, communication, and follow-up before assuming a team model or solo model is better.

Consumer action plan

How to use this brief

Open several profiles instead of contacting one result from search.
Ask each agent for recent experience in the exact neighbourhood or property type.
Verify brokerage, licensing, review links, and any award or production claim.
Use the same interview questions across buyer agents, listing agents, and teams.
Submit a correction when public profile information appears outdated.
Interview prompts

Questions for Whitehorse agents

Which Whitehorse neighbourhoods do you actively work in right now?
What property types do you handle most often?
Which profile claims can I verify before choosing representation?
Who handles showings, offer strategy, negotiation, and follow-up?
How do you communicate during evenings, weekends, and offer deadlines?
How are referrals, advertising, or sponsored placement disclosed?
